CME welcomes Spring Red-Tape Reduction Bill

Dennis Darby, President and CEO of CME issued the following statement with regards to the red-tape reduction proposals announced today by the Government of Ontario: 

“Manufacturers welcome today’s announcement by the Government of Ontario which will further reduce the regulatory burden for manufacturers. Complying with regulations currently costs our Ontario members in average $33, 000 a year, more than in any other province. 

Specifically, we were pleased to see measures to modernize environmental compliance practices, modernize workplace health and safety requirements and provides employers with free and instant access to employee training verification.

We look forward to working with the Government of Ontario on working towards achieving a world-class, agile regulatory system that supports innovation and investment, while protecting the environment, and the health and safety of Ontarians. 

ABOUT CANADIAN MANUFACTURERS & EXPORTERS

Since 1871, Canadian Manufacturers & Exporters has been helping manufacturers grow at home and, compete around the world. Our focus is to ensure manufacturers are recognized as engines for growth in the economy, with Canada acknowledged as both a global leader and innovator in advanced manufacturing and a global leader in exporting. CME is a member-driven association that directly represents more than 2,500 leading companies who account for an estimated 82 per cent of manufacturing output and 90 per cent of Canada’s exports.
